Re: cache invalidation in the Merrow catalog service — please note that price updates publish an invalidation event, but category-tree changes rely on TTL expiry only. If you're paged for stale listings, check whether the event bus lagged past the TTL window before restarting workers; a restart alone won't flush entries that missed their event. The relevant TTLs and retry bounds are defined in one place, reproduced below.

tuning constants:
RATE_LIMITS = {
    "wenwyn": 1,
    "zorix": 10,
    "oliix": 2,
    "holael": 10,
}

Review scope: the Tabulode import wizard. Confirm uploads are capped at 25 MB, parsed in the sandboxed `csvwork` process, and never evaluated as formulas. Column-mapping templates are user-supplied; verify they pass schema validation before persistence. Check that rejected rows are quarantined, not logged verbatim. Once the checklist passes, sign off by countersigning the release manifest — unsigned manifests block the deploy gate. Countersigning requires the reviewer key issued for this cycle, shown below.

rollout seal: bky9_PeXH1fTLY

Minutes — Management Meeting, Varnholt Trading Ltd.
Present: M. Quellen (Chair), R. Sabety, L. Drennan.

The renewal of our commercial liability cover with Ostbridge Mutual was reviewed in detail. Premiums rise 11% owing to last year's warehouse claim in Tarvale. Sabety will obtain two comparative quotes before the 30th; no lapse in cover is acceptable. Sales leads should note the terms below before client commitments are made.

confidential, kagep-kahof: Druokax Systems plans to lower the Ulaath list price by 53 percent in March.